Key Buying Factors for Security Camera NVRs for Content Creators
Resolution and Detail
Higher resolution helps when you need to zoom into footage, review incidents, or pull clearer reference clips. For creators, sharper footage can also be useful for verifying deliveries, monitoring gear storage, or documenting set access.
Storage and Retention
Longer retention matters if you don’t check footage daily. Systems with larger included hard drives reduce setup friction, while no-HDD kits are better if you want to choose your own drive size from the start.
Channel Count and Expansion
Think beyond your current layout. An 8-channel NVR may be enough for a small setup, but 16-channel models give you room for entrances, studio spaces, parking areas, and blind spots.
Wired Reliability
PoE NVR kits are usually the most dependable choice for content creators because they combine power and data over one cable, which simplifies installation and tends to be more stable than fully wireless systems.
Audio and Smart Alerts
If your workflow includes monitoring a front door, production room, or equipment storage area, audio support and motion alerts can be helpful. Just remember that alert quality depends on placement and tuning, not just the spec sheet.
